Usage
=====

.. code:: python

   from fastcrc import crc8, crc16, crc32, crc64

   data = b"123456789"
   print(f"crc8 checksum with cdma2000 algorithm: {crc8.cdma2000(data)}")
   print(f"crc16 checksum with xmodem algorithm: {crc16.xmodem(data)}")
   print(f"crc32 checksum with aixm algorithm: {crc32.aixm(data)}")
   print(f"crc64 checksum with ecma_182 algorithm: {crc64.ecma_182(data)}")
   print(f"crc16 checksum with xmodem algorithm (with initial data): {crc16.xmodem(b'56789', crc16.xmodem(b'1234'))}")

   # Any bytes-like object works without copying, e.g. a slice of a larger buffer.
   buffer = bytearray(b"header:123456789")
   print(f"crc32 checksum of a memoryview slice: {crc32.iscsi(memoryview(buffer)[7:])}")

Notes
=====

* ``data`` may be any object that supports the buffer protocol (``bytes``, ``bytearray``,
  ``memoryview``, ``array``, ``mmap``, NumPy arrays, ...). It is read in place without copying,
  so do not modify it from another thread while its checksum is being computed.
* Inputs of 16 KiB and more are processed with the GIL released, so threads can compute
  checksums in parallel. The free-threaded build of CPython is supported.

Performance
===========

CRC-16, CRC-32 and CRC-64 use SIMD carry-less multiplication (PCLMULQDQ/VPCLMULQDQ on x86,
PMULL on aarch64) with a table-based fallback elsewhere; CRC-8 uses slice-by-16 tables. The
best method for the CPU is picked at run time, so the wheels run everywhere.

Single-threaded throughput on an AMD Ryzen 7 9700X (Zen 5) with CPython 3.14, in GB/s:

===========  ============  ==============  ============  ==========  ==========
Input        crc32.iscsi   crc32.iso_hdlc  crc16.xmodem  crc64.xz    crc8.smbus
===========  ============  ==============  ============  ==========  ==========
64 B         2.4           1.6             1.8           1.3         2.6
1 KiB        23.6          24.2            23.6          21.6        8.3
1 MiB        87.2          86.6            86.1          86.8        9.3
===========  ============  ==============  ============  ==========  ==========
